We were proud to welcome the New England Patriots Foundation and Bank of America to Chelsea this week and receive their donation of $50,000 for our Survival Center programs. La Colaborativa was recently named a “Community Captain” and honored at Gillette Stadium. To get a better look at our work in Chelsea, this week Josh Kraft, President of the Patriots Foundation, and Miceal Chamberlain, President of Bank of America Massachusetts, toured our space, met with staff, and saw our food and diaper distributions in action.
